Ethos, Pathos, and Logos...

Aristotle has three persuasive appeal techniques, which include ethos, the appeal to credibility; pathos, the appeal to emotion; and logos, the appeal to logic, by using facts. Most advertisements use these three appeals to sell their items and products.

There is a Peta ad that has a celebrity by the name of Steve-O, that is a great example of ethos. Steve-O because he is in this ad uses all three appeals, ethos; because him being a celebrity makes the ad trustworthy and worth looking at, pathos; because Steve-O is mostly a crazy and hilarious guy, but because he looks serious in this ad people tend to take this more seriously, and logos; because there is info on the ad that explains why Steve-O is so concerned about the seals.

One reason they used Steve-O in this ad is because Steve-O is known for never backing down from anything. So if he will never back down from anything when he is out goofing around, then when he is serious there is no doubt that he will not back down from trying to save the seals, and that more than likely more and more people will try to help.
